Transaction 23e893dddcef26144f17e72ab4354e3071c1cb7bf36806094ffd448dab786458
1 Input
1 Output
-
23e893dddcef26144f17e72ab4354e3071c1cb7bf36806094ffd448dab786458:0
- value
- 131390
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 012582f9ca62842a0ecc23540d08d09f3b2491fb OP_EQUALVERIFY OP_CHECKSIG
- address
- 174cYcuxszHDxnNyWogqgePks3iyfETyh